Egyptian forward Mohamed Zidan scored a hat-trick to lead Mainz to a thrashing 4-1 home victory over Energie Cottbus in the Bundesliga on Saturday.

The score was 1-1 when Zidan started scoring. He added the 2nd and then the 3rd from a penalty kick to end the first half in a 3-1 lead for Mainz. In the 2nd half, the Egyptian added another goal to end the game in a 4-1 win for Mainz
Zidan's first goal came in the 22nd minute when Sato sent a through pass to the onside Egyptian who sent the ball low to give Mainz the lead once again.


Five minutes before half time, the referee awarded Mainz a penalty kick and Zizou scored from the spot confidently as he sent the goalkeeper the wrong way and placed the ball calmly into the bottom corner to make the score 3-1 for Mainz.

In the 2nd half, Zidan added the 4th goal for Mainz to seal his hat-trick in the 61st minute, the goal came after a fine through pass across the field from Sato to Zidan who was onside and had only the keeper to beat, the Egyptian kept his nerve and played the ball gently beyond the oncoming goalkeeper to end the game in a 4-1 win which put Mainz in the 14th spot in the table.


It should be noted that Cottbus goalkeeper saved another goal for Zizou when he parried a low shot from the Egyptian after a few minutes from the kick off of the 2nd half.
